In Loving Memory of Reverend Eusebio Florido August 14, 1939 – September 5, 2025
Reverend Eusebio Florido was born in Monterrey, Mexico, on August 14, 1939, and entered his eternal rest in Dallas, Texas, on September 5, 2025, at the age of 86. For 67 years, he faithfully served as a minister of the gospel, preaching Christ with conviction and leading multitudes around the world to salvation and healing. He pastored Templo Peña de Horeb Pentecostés in Dallas, where his love for God and for people shined brightly. His life was marked by prayer, humility, and an unshakable faith in the Lord he adored. He is survived by his devoted wife, Josefina; their children, Margarita, Elias, Abel, Ruben, Flor Dalhia, and Benjamin; and nine grandchildren, Atsiri Zulet, Irasema Linet, Ruben Dario, Jonathan Brad, Jillian Jeannette, Leah Elizabeth, Jason Elias, Rebekah Elise, and Jaylynn Nicole; and two great-grandchildren, Brody Jameson and Charli Jade. He is also survived by his adopted daughter, Celina, and her children, Dalhia and Marisol, and his sister, Sofía. He was preceded in death by his son, David. Rev. Florido leaves behind a legacy of unwavering devotion to God and countless lives transformed by the power of the gospel he preached. Funeral services to honor and celebrate his life will be held at Templo Pena de Horeb Pentecostés on Friday September 12, 2025 at 9:30 am. He will be laid to rest in Oak Groves Memorial Cemetery. "I have fought the good fight, I have finished the race, I have kept the faith." – 2 Timothy 4:7 "Well done, good and faithful servant enter into the joy of your Lord." – Matthew 25:23
